// Code generated by smithy-go-codegen DO NOT EDIT.
package databasemigrationservice
import (
"context"
awsmiddleware "github.com/aws/aws-sdk-go-v2/aws/middleware"
"github.com/aws/aws-sdk-go-v2/aws/signer/v4"
"github.com/aws/aws-sdk-go-v2/service/databasemigrationservice/types"
"github.com/awslabs/smithy-go/middleware"
smithyhttp "github.com/awslabs/smithy-go/transport/http"
)
// Reboots a replication instance. Rebooting results in a momentary outage, until
// the replication instance becomes available again.
func (c *Client) RebootReplicationInstance(ctx context.Context, params *RebootReplicationInstanceInput, optFns ...func(*Options)) (*RebootReplicationInstanceOutput, error) {
if params == nil {
params = &RebootReplicationInstanceInput{}
}
result, metadata, err := c.invokeOperation(ctx, "RebootReplicationInstance", params, optFns, addOperationRebootReplicationInstanceMiddlewares)
if err != nil {
return nil, err
}
out := result.(*RebootReplicationInstanceOutput)
out.ResultMetadata = metadata
return out, nil
}
type RebootReplicationInstanceInput struct {
// The Amazon Resource Name (ARN) of the replication instance.
//
// This member is required.
ReplicationInstanceArn *string
// If this parameter is true, the reboot is conducted through a Multi-AZ failover.
// (If the instance isn't configured for Multi-AZ, then you can't specify true.)
ForceFailover *bool
}
type RebootReplicationInstanceOutput struct {
// The replication instance that is being rebooted.
ReplicationInstance *types.ReplicationInstance
// Metadata pertaining to the operation's result.
ResultMetadata middleware.Metadata
}
func addOperationRebootReplicationInstanceMiddlewares(stack *middleware.Stack, options Options) (err error) {
err = stack.Serialize.Add(&awsAwsjson11_serializeOpRebootReplicationInstance{}, middleware.After)
if err != nil {
return err
}
err = stack.Deserialize.Add(&awsAwsjson11_deserializeOpRebootReplicationInstance{}, middleware.After)
if err != nil {
return err
}
awsmiddleware.AddRequestInvocationIDMiddleware(stack)
smithyhttp.AddContentLengthMiddleware(stack)
addResolveEndpointMiddleware(stack, options)
v4.AddComputePayloadSHA256Middleware(stack)
addRetryMiddlewares(stack, options)
addHTTPSignerV4Middleware(stack, options)
awsmiddleware.AddAttemptClockSkewMiddleware(stack)
addClientUserAgent(stack)
smithyhttp.AddErrorCloseResponseBodyMiddleware(stack)
smithyhttp.AddCloseResponseBodyMiddleware(stack)
addOpRebootReplicationInstanceValidationMiddleware(stack)
stack.Initialize.Add(newServiceMetadataMiddleware_opRebootReplicationInstance(options.Region), middleware.Before)
addRequestIDRetrieverMiddleware(stack)
addResponseErrorMiddleware(stack)
return nil
}
func newServiceMetadataMiddleware_opRebootReplicationInstance(region string) awsmiddleware.RegisterServiceMetadata {
return awsmiddleware.RegisterServiceMetadata{
Region: region,
ServiceID: ServiceID,
SigningName: "dms",
OperationName: "RebootReplicationInstance",
}
}
